Kenya vs Angola
Kenya and Angola compared across 14 demographic and economic metrics. Angola leads in 5 of the comparable categories.
| Metric | Kenya | Angola |
|---|---|---|
| Population | 55,339,003 | 36,749,906 |
| GDP Per Capita | $1,943 | $2,916 |
| Life Expectancy | 63.6 | 64.6 |
| Population Growth Rate | 1.98 | 3.08 |
| Urban Population | 31.6% | 69.9% |
| Fertility Rate | 3.21 | 5.12 |
| Infant Mortality (per 1000) | 34.7 | 33.0 |
| Literacy Rate | - | 68.2% |
| Unemployment Rate | 5.4% | 14.1% |
| Internet Users | 29.4% | 35.8% |
| CO2 Per Capita (tonnes) | - | - |
| Physicians Per 1000 | 0.29 | 0.24 |
| Gini Index | 38.5 | - |
| Forest Area | 6.2% | 52.1% |
